**Briefing: Marrowgate Supplies Contract Renewal**

For sales leads: we intend to renew the Marrowgate contract for two years at improved volume tiers. Lead times drop from ten days to six, which should ease the backlog complaints from key accounts. Pricing holds flat through year one. The strategic context appears in the note below.

board note of kageg-bahof: The renewal with Holwynax Holdings closes at $2 million a year, 5 percent below the last contract. Project Ulaath slips by two quarters because of the supplier delay.

- Interview suite (Room 4B, Hartwell Annex): contractors must be escorted at all times. No phones, no laptops unless cleared by Veltrane Security desk. Sign the access log on entry and exit. Door auto-locks after 30 seconds; do not prop it open. If the panel flashes amber, wait and re-try — do not force the handle. Leave the room as found, chairs stacked, blinds down. Enter the code below at the keypad.

staff pass of kawip-hawef = bdg-QLP-2

**Vendor note: Inkmill markdown pipeline**

Rendering for Parchway docs is outsourced to Inkmill under an annual contract, renewing each March. They handle sanitization and PDF export; we own the upload queue. SLA: 4-hour response on rendering failures. Escalate only after two failed retries. Their support desk is reachable at the address below.

billing contact of hahaf-baguf = zorael.tammir.jorius@sivrelhq.internal

# Approvals — Telemetry payload compression

The Marlow agent now compresses telemetry payloads with dictionary-trained zstd before upload. On-call engineers: do not disable compression in production without approval, as the ingest tier rejects oversized raw payloads and alerts will cascade. Emergency bypass requires the documented flag plus a follow-up review within 24 hours. All such bypasses and any compression-config changes must be approved by the person named below.

account owner for fajep-faweg: Jorwyn Rusok Zorath Norius